The sound of a book being slammed shut is a great way for a character who just had their nose buried in it make it clear that they mean business (or sometimes, [[OhCrap they've realised something else does]]). Being a relatively quick and loud gesture makes it the perfect way to interrupt the more passive action of reading (or writing, [[SignificantSketchBook or drawing]], [[MrExposition or dictating]] or whatever the would-be literate was doing before they were so rudely interrupted). A character who wasn't that engrossed might still close a book they had open nearby as a sort of [[IShallTauntYou pre-battle taunt]].

If a character's being distracted or otherwise harassed while they're reading, [[TranquilFury calmly but loudly]] clapping the book shut usually indicates that they've had enough. Teachers have a specific variation, where they'll snap a book they're reading from shut to get the attention of an inattentive pupil. Another variant has the character casually holding a book in an open palm (using the other hand to turn pages or follow the text with their finger) and quickly closing it and stowing it one-handed (often after pulling it out in some dangerous situation).

The BadassBookworm and WarriorPoet like using this as an AsskickingPose (especially the one-handed version with the latter, since reading a book mid-battle makes for a good source of DissonantSerenity). The [[MagicIsMental more scholarly sort of wizard]] is more likely to use the "taunt" variation (in the same way a more martially minded warrior might brandish a sword). For other characters with books, the chance of it happening is [[ChekhovsGun inversely proportional to how often a given character reads]]. If a BookDumb warrior ends up forced to read, it's almost a given they'll dramatically slam it shut (and possibly brain someone with it) as soon as the opportunity presents itself.

Compare TheGlassesComeOff (another dramatic gesture with intellectual roots) and ThrowTheBookAtThem (when the book is used as a weapon).
